Here are the top four stories today in Smithtown:
- The Holidays are the perfect time to give back to the community and help the less fortunate. The Smithtown Public Library accepts donations of unwrapped toys until Dec. 7. The generous donations are going to the "ReesSpecht Life" foundation. (Smithtown Public Library)
- St. James Episcopal Church is hosting a Holiday sale through Dec. 3. Books and things will be available at 490 North Country Road in St. James from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. The event support local vendors who are offering remarkable holiday findings. (Smithtown Patch)
- A new holiday attraction is now open! The Christmas House Long Island is at the Smith Haven Mall and expects to host over 100,000 visitors in the Christmas season. (LI News 12)
- The holiday season brings Christmas and Hanukkah events in the Smithtown area. Four holiday gatherings are coming to nearby towns. Visit the link to find out where and when to go to enjoy the magic of the season in the community. (Port Jefferson Patch)

- St. James Community Association has announced on its social media page the Winter Walk 2022! The event will be held on Saturday, Dec. 17, from 3 to 9 p.m. Several performances will be hosted during the walk, which starts on Lake Avenue and marches down Woodlawn Avenue. The Smithtown Patch will remind you as this "happening" gets closer. (Facebook Events)
